Where This Product Is Used
The Allen-Bradley 1769-PB4 is a 24VDC input power supply module purpose-built for the CompactLogix 1769 I/O system. It is deployed wherever a compact, rail-mounted control architecture must deliver stable, regulated power to a bank of 1769 I/O modules without relying on the main controller’s internal bus supply. Typical installation environments include:
- Automotive assembly lines – powering distributed I/O banks on body-in-white welding cells and paint-shop conveyor controls
- Food & beverage packaging – supplying 24VDC logic power to filling, capping, and labeling machine I/O racks in washdown-adjacent panels
- Water & wastewater treatment – energising remote I/O segments in pump-station MCC panels where panel space is at a premium
- Oil & gas upstream/midstream – providing isolated power segments in wellhead RTU enclosures and pipeline SCADA panels
- Pharmaceutical manufacturing – supporting validated control panels where each I/O bank must have a dedicated, auditable power source
- Material handling & logistics – driving sorter and conveyor I/O nodes in high-cycle distribution-centre automation
Wherever engineers need to extend a CompactLogix system beyond the native bus-power budget, or segment power domains for fault isolation, the 1769-PB4 is the specified solution.
Technical Specifications
| Parameter | Value |
|---|---|
| Part Number | 1769-PB4 |
| Product Family | Allen-Bradley CompactLogix 1769 I/O |
| Module Type | Power Supply / Bus Expansion Module |
| Input Voltage | 24V DC (nominal) |
| Output Current | 4 A (to 1769 I/O bus) |
| Mounting | DIN rail (35 mm) or panel mount via 1769 system rail |
| Communication | 1769 backplane bus (right-side connection) |
| Operating Temperature | 0 °C to 60 °C (32 °F to 140 °F) |
| Storage Temperature | -40 °C to 85 °C |
| Relative Humidity | 5 % to 95 % (non-condensing) |
| Enclosure Rating | Open type – install in suitable enclosure |
| Agency Certifications | UL, CE, C-Tick (verify current listing with Rockwell) |
| Weight | Approx. 1.2 kg (as shipped) |
Note: Always verify specifications against the official Rockwell Automation 1769-PB4 product page and installation instructions before engineering design-in.
Why Engineers Specify This Model
- Dedicated bus power budget – Adds 4 A of 24VDC bus current, allowing engineers to expand I/O banks beyond the controller’s native supply limit without redesigning the entire panel.
- Power domain segmentation – Isolates downstream I/O modules from upstream faults, improving system availability and simplifying fault diagnostics.
- Compact form factor – Slots directly into the 1769 system rail with no additional wiring harness, minimising panel footprint and assembly time.
- Proven field reliability – The 1769 platform has accumulated millions of operating hours across global process and discrete manufacturing sites.
- Simplified sparing – A single module type covers a wide range of I/O expansion scenarios, reducing spare-parts inventory complexity.
- Seamless integration – Works transparently with Studio 5000 / RSLogix 5000 project configurations; no additional software licensing required for the power module itself.
Complete System Bill of Materials
The 1769-PB4 is typically ordered alongside the following components to build a complete CompactLogix I/O expansion segment:
- 1769-L3x / 1769-L2x – CompactLogix controller (host of the 1769 I/O system)
- 1769-ECR / 1769-ECL – Right-end cap or left-end cap to terminate the I/O bank
- 1769-IQ16 / 1769-OB16 – Digital input / output modules (16-point, 24VDC)
- 1769-IF4 / 1769-OF4 – Analog input / output modules (4-channel)
- 1769-SDN – DeviceNet scanner module (if DeviceNet field devices are present)
- 1769-ARM – Address reservation module (for slot reservation in mixed I/O banks)
- 1492-CABLE series – Pre-wired I/O cables for rapid field termination

Application-Specific FAQ
- Q: Can the 1769-PB4 be used with a 1769-L30ER or 1769-L33ER controller?
- A: Yes. The 1769-PB4 is compatible with all CompactLogix controllers that use the 1769 I/O system rail. It extends the bus power budget for I/O modules connected to the right of the module.
- Q: How many 1769-PB4 modules can I install in a single I/O bank?
- A: Rockwell Automation specifies the maximum number of power supply modules per bank in the 1769 system installation instructions. Consult publication 1769-IN031 or the system design guide for your specific controller model.
- Q: What is the difference between the 1769-PB4 and the 1769-PA4?
- A: The 1769-PB4 accepts 24V DC input, while the 1769-PA4 accepts 120/240V AC input. Both deliver 4 A to the 1769 I/O bus. Selection depends on the available panel supply voltage.
